0G is a modular Layer 1 blockchain that serves as a decentralized AI operating system. It supports AI applications on-chain through scalable storage and computing resources. Its infrastructure enables verifiable AI models and real-time use cases. With cross-chain compatibility, 0G connects to Layer 1 and Layer 2 networks, decentralized physical infrastructure networks (DePIN), gaming ecosystems, and zero-knowledge (ZK) proof systems, laying a solid groundwork for decentralized AI.
